Adoption Studies
Research methods in psychology and sociology that compare adopted children to their adoptive and biological parents to understand genetic and environmental influences.
Twin Studies
Research involving the comparison of monozygotic (identical) and dizygotic (fraternal) twins to explore the relative contribution of genetics and environment to various traits and disorders.
Hofstede's Dimensions
A framework for cross-cultural communication, developed by Geert Hofstede, that describes the effects of a society's culture on the values of its members, and how these values relate to behavior, using a structure derived from factor analysis.
